Transaction 4780d03eb0b83fc1375f4a36a6c24e51ed9c4747aaf6263ae11c3840ab309813
3 Input
2 Outputs
- 4780d03eb0b83fc1375f4a36a6c24e51ed9c4747aaf6263ae11c3840ab309813:0
- 4780d03eb0b83fc1375f4a36a6c24e51ed9c4747aaf6263ae11c3840ab309813:1
value 244454
address 1BSWo9QxSGWWgRh4GYPzntBbsR8GmrLUHi
value 1107226
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c